Hirni - Bandgaon, West Singhbhum
Hirni is a village situated in the Bandgaon subdivision of West Singhbhum district, Jharkhand. It is located approximately 46 km from Chakhardharpur and around 69 km from Chaibasa. Sawania serves as the Gram Panchayat for Hirni village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Hirni is 377140. The village covers a total geographical area of 138 hectares and falls under the 833201 pincode.
Hirni village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Chakradharpur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Singhbhum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Hirni
As per Census 2011, Hirni village has a total population of 250 people, consisting of 125 males and 125 females. The village has 45 households and a sex ratio of 1,000 females per 1,000 males. There are 46 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 96 literate and 154 illiterate residents. Additionally, 250 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Hirni are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 250 | 125 | 125 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 46 | 30 | 16 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 250 | 125 | 125 |
| Literate Population | 96 | 53 | 43 |
| Illiterate Population | 154 | 72 | 82 |

Transport and Connectivity of Hirni
Public transport facilities are available within >10 km of the Hirni.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within <5 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. the road distance from Chaibasa to Hirni is about 69 km, with the usual travel time around ~2 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
